Part Details | CERAMIC DIELECTRIC FIXED CAPACITOR

5910-00-904-3621 A capacitor, whose capacitance value cannot be adjusted or varied, having a ceramic dielectric. It may be a single unit, or consist of two or more fixed units which cannot be separated.

Technical Data | NSN 5910-00-904-3621
Characteristic Specifications
CAPACITANCE VALUE PER SECTION47.000 PICOFARADS SINGLE SECTION
TOLERANCE RANGE PER SECTION-5.00 TO +5.00 PERCENT SINGLE SECTION
NONDERATED CONTINUOUS VOLTAGE RATING AND TYPE PER SECTION200.0 DC SINGLE SECTION
VOLTAGE TEMP LIMITS PER SECTION IN PERCENT CAPACITANCE CHANGEC10.0 TO +10.0 WITH RATED VOLTAGE APPLIED
NONDERATED OPERATING TEMP-55.0 DEG CELSIUS MINIMUM AND 150.0 DEG CELSIUS MAXIMUM
BODY STYLE W/O MTG FACILITIES TERMINAL(S) ON ONE SURFACE
BODY LENGTH0.190 INCHES NOMINAL
BODY WIDTH0.190 INCHES NOMINAL
BODY HEIGHT0.090 INCHES NOMINAL
SCHEMATIC DIAGRAM DESIGNATOR NO COMMON OR GROUNDED ELECTRODE(S)
TERMINAL TYPE AND QUANTITY2 UNINSULATED WIRE LEAD
TERMINAL LENGTH1.250 INCHES MINIMUM
CENTER TO CENTER DISTANCE BETWEEN TERMINALS PARALLEL TO LENGTH0.185 INCHES MINIMUM AND 0.215 INCHES MAXIMUM
CASE MATERIAL CERAMIC
INSULATION RESISTANCE AT REFERENCE TEMP100000.0 MEGOHMS
DISSIPATION FACTOR AT REFERENCE TEMP IN PERCENT1.5000
RELIABILITY INDICATOR NOT ESTABLISHED
TERMINAL SURFACE TREATMENT SOLDER
INSULATION RESISTANCE AT MAXIMUM OPERATING TEMP10000.0 MEGOHMS
